Chimney Assessment in Oakland, CA
Chimney assessment services provide homeowners with a thorough inspection of their chimney systems to identify potential issues and ensure safe operation. This service typically covers both interior and exterior components, including masonry, flue liners, chimney caps, and ventilation pathways. Property owners often request assessments when preparing for seasonal use, experiencing draft problems, noticing signs of damage or deterioration, or before purchasing a new home. Understanding the current condition of a chimney helps prevent costly repairs and ensures the safety of household occupants.
Before requesting a chimney assessment, property owners usually want to know what specific concerns or symptoms prompted the inspection, such as smoke backups, unusual odors, or visible damage. It’s also helpful to understand the age of the chimney, previous repair history, and any recent weather events that may have impacted its structure. Clear communication about these details can support a comprehensive evaluation, providing peace of mind and guidance for any necessary maintenance or repairs.

Chimney Assessment Questions
What is a chimney assessment? It is an inspection process to evaluate the condition and safety of a chimney, identifying any issues that may need repair or maintenance.
When should a chimney assessment be performed? It is recommended after noticing draft problems, visible damage, or before installing a new appliance that connects to the chimney.
What does a chimney assessment include? The assessment typically involves checking the chimney’s structure, lining, and venting system for cracks, blockages, or deterioration.
Why is regular chimney assessment important? Regular assessments help prevent potential fire hazards, improve efficiency, and ensure the chimney functions properly over time.
